“First get followers, then you will get work”… Divya Dutta’s big statement on social media, targeted at the industry

Tezzbuzz Desk – Well-known and talented Bollywood actress Divya Dutta has worked in more than 100 films in her long career. He has made a special mark with his strong acting in films like Bhaag Milkha Bhaag, Veer-Zaara and Delhi-6.

Recently she was seen in the show ‘Chiraiya’, where during a conversation, she openly expressed her opinion on the changing trends in the industry and the increasing influence of social media.

Social media changed the picture of the industry

Divya Dutta told that in today’s time, along with acting, social media followers also matter a lot. According to him, now many times digital presence is given more importance than talent.

He said that today’s times have changed a lot, where many times the followers of artists are seen first and then they are offered projects.

“First get followers, then you will get work”

Sharing her experience, Divya Dutta said that in earlier times it was very difficult to get work, but now people get recognized quickly through social media and reels. He said that nowadays even one reel can give someone recognition overnight and producers pay immediate attention to such talent.

He said that while on one hand this change is increasing opportunities, on the other hand it is also creating a new pressure in the industry.

Remembered the early days

Divya Dutta also told that when she started her career, the circumstances were quite difficult. At that time neither there were so many platforms nor opportunities were easily available.

He believes that social media has become a big tool for today’s actors, but challenges have also increased with it.

During the conversation, Divya Dutta also shared her views on financial security. She said that she considers herself lucky that she had a strong family support.
